POLYX is the native token powering Polymesh, an institutional-grade blockchain specifically designed for regulated asset tokenization and security token offerings. Launched in 2021 by Polymath, Polymesh addresses key challenges including governance complexities, identity verification, compliance automation, and settlement inefficiencies in traditional finance. As of January 2026, with 6,077 active holders and a market cap of $80.76 million, POLYX enables governance, staking, and transaction validation through its Nominated Proof-of-Stake consensus mechanism. The platform's purpose-built compliance features, institutional infrastructure, and strategic focus on digital securities distinguish it from general-purpose blockchains.
